Best Veggies For Raised Planters. If you want to save precious raised bed space and enjoy multiple harvests, try planting sprouting broccoli. Chard, also known as leaf beet, is another vegetable that does well in raised planting beds. Bush beans bush beans are one of the best vegetables to grow in raised beds because they’re quick, easy, and compact. Most varieties begin to crop a mere 50 to 55 days from seeding.
